------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 Alorian Cynghrair Liberty · Alorian Freiheit Allianz · Alorian Liberty Alliance 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 The Alorian Liberty Alliance was founded in 3919 as the Social-Liberal party and defines its goal bringing freedom and prosperity for everyone in our society. This means helping genuinely disadvantaged and stopping state-imposed freedom restrictions. The Social-Liberal party was reformed in 3827 by decision of its central commitee. It is now open for all both economic left and right, with the common goal of bringing liberty to people of Aloria. The SLP was renamed to Alorian Liberty Alliance. We are for unconditioned minimum income and unconditioned children benefits. We are against growing state bureacracy and for smaller efficient government which works on simple principles. We support unconditioned universal health care and education, but private efforts in these areas are appreciated and private facilities are allowed because we are against any state-imposed prohibitions. === MAIN POSITIONS === Individual Freedom Economic Freedom Unconditional basic income Public Health Care & Education Protection of the Enviroment Globalization, Internationalism, Free Trade --- FACTIONS --- Geolibertarian 55% Right-libertarian 35% Other/Unaffiliated 10% === IDEOLOGY === Our main position is to maximize liberty of an individual. Violations of freedom can be imposed by the government or by individual ownership and private corporations. Private ownership of natural resources and land is essencially prohibition of using these common resources by other people, therefore violating their freedom. This means it should be compensated by the government. The government should not prohibit private enterprise because prohibition is violation of freedom, but if a large and effective government sector makes private companies uncompetitive, then this is not freedom violation, as there is no compulsion. The usage of commons also should be regulated by the government to avoid depletion. We think that the government should protect enviroment because this is a common good. We are anti-copyright because this is essencially creation of artificial monopolies through prohibition and freedom violation, and therefore is unjust and uneffective. The government is necessary to protect people from crime. Crime is basically actions with net positive private coersion. Organized crime structures resemble archaic anti-people governments, and a stronger democratic government is necessary to maximize liberty. We don't have set positions on ecomomic policies and allow a wide range of views within our party. Our party position is that economic system should maximize individual freedom and be effective. Our combined economic position is centrist.
